South Australia and the NSW town of Broken Hill move from ACST to Australian Central Daylight Time (ACDT), and clocks are advanced to UTC +10.5.ĭaylight saving is not observed in Queensland, the Northern Territory or Western Australia.įor more information about time zones and daylight saving in other Australian states and territories, visit time zones and daylight saving on the Australian Government website. Lord Howe Island moves from LHST to Lord Howe Daylight Time (LHDT), and clocks are advanced to UTC +11. Besides, Australia also has offshore external territories which observe different time zones. There are 5 time zones, in Australia from west to east: Western Australian Time (Perth)- Western Central Australian Time (Eucla) - Central Australian Time, North (Darwin) & South (Adelaide) ) - Eastern Australian Time (Sydney, Melbourne, Hobart) - Lord Howe Time. NSW (except Broken Hill and Lord Howe Island), the Australian Capital Territory, Victoria and Tasmania move from AEST to Australian Eastern Daylight Time (AEDT), and clocks are advanced to UTC +11. Australia has three different time zones and the time in Australia varies between Eastern, Central and Western Standard Time (EST, CST, WST). Australia’s three time zones are Australian Eastern Standard Time (AEST), Australian Central Standard Time (ACST), and Australian Western Standard Time (AWST). In periods of daylight saving an hour is added to the Local Standard Time (except for on Lord Howe Island where 30 minutes is added).
